<blockquote><p>Allison Iraheta Defends Adam LambertExtraTV ExtraTV.com 12/07/09 03:44 PM </p>
<p>Adam Lambert may have sparked controversy with his raunchy performance at the American Music Awards, but fellow &#8220;American Idol&#8221; contestant Allison Iraheta still has his back. &#8220;Let me say, I think he did amazing,&#8221; Iraheta, 17, tells &#8220;Extra,&#8221; adding, &#8220;That&#8217;s who he is.&#8221; Lambert, 27, was upset when ABC censored his performance, but recently admitted he got &#8220;carried away&#8221; at the awards ceremony. </p>
<p>Allison says that &#8220;nobody should have been surprised&#8221; at Adam&#8217;s sexually-charged performance. &#8220;You guys know what Adam&#8217;s doing,&#8221; she says, laughing. &#8220;You know what&#8217;s coming.&#8221; </p>
<p>After several axed performances, Adam will perform on &#8220;The View&#8221; December 10. </p></blockquote>
